OTTAWA, ONTARIO --- Building on its 25-year legacy as the Canadian Navy's systems integrator, Lockheed Martin Canada and its Halifax-Class Modernization (HCM) industry team today announced the signing of two contracts totaling approximately C$2 billion for the installation, integration and long-term in-service support of a new combat system for Canada's Halifax-Class frigates.>> The Combat Systems Integration (CSI) contract will provide a new command and control system, radars, tactical data links, electronic support measures and other warfare capabilities for the Canadian Navy's 12 Halifax-class frigates, which were commissioned between 1992 and 1997

RGB Spectrum, a California-based firm, is a leading designer and manufacturer of cutting-edge videographic products for military applications. RGB product range includes scan converters, video windowing systems, multi-input processors, keyers/overlayers, switchers, video scalers, multi-screen displays, and scan rate recording devices, says Bhavneet Kaveshar, an application engineer with the company, in response to a query at the firm’s stall in the defence exhibition INDESEC 2008
